#8b0495 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8b0495 is composed of 54.5% red, 1.6%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.7% cyan, 97.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 295.9 degrees, a saturation of 94.8% and a lightness of 30%. #8b0495 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ff08ff with #17002b.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

#8b0495 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8b0495 has RGB values of R:139, G:4,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0.97,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9110677.

Hex triplet 8b0495 #8b0495
RGB Decimal 139, 4, 149 rgb(139,4,149)
RGB Percent 54.5, 1.6, 58.4 rgb(54.5%,1.6%,58.4%)
CMYK 7, 97, 0, 42
HSL 295.9°, 94.8, 30 hsl(295.9,94.8%,30%)
HSV (or HSB) 295.9°, 97.3, 58.4
Web Safe 990099 #990099
CIE-LAB 33.45, 63.593, -43.537
XYZ 16.115, 7.747, 29.079
xyY 0.304, 0.146, 7.747
CIE-LCH 33.45, 77.069, 325.603
CIE-LUV 33.45, 41.642, -65.565
Hunter-Lab 27.833, 54.643, -42.46
Binary 10001011, 00000100, 10010101

Shades and Tints of #8b0495

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e000f is the darkest color, while #fffb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#8b0495

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e4b4e is the less saturated color, while #8b0495 is the most saturated one.
